Objective] To investigate the chemical constituents from higher Fungi Phellinus rhabarbarinus (Berk.) G.Cunn.[Method] Sev-eral modern chromatographic separation methods were adopted , such as gel,positive silica gel, and negative silica gel.Nuclear magnetic reso-nance and other spectroscopy methods were used to identify the chemical structure of the isolated chemical compounds , so as to determine their structure.[Result] A total of five chemical compounds were isolated from P.rhabarba rinus, which were two phenylcyclopropane derivatives, two triterpenes and one steroids.[Conclusion] All the chemical compounds are isolated from this kind of the higher fungi for the first time.%[目的]研究高等真菌黑壳木层孔菌的化学成分。[方法]利用正向硅胶、反向硅胶、凝胶等现代色谱分离手段,采用核磁共振等波谱学方法对分离的化合物进行化学结构鉴定。[结果]从高等真菌黑壳木层孔菌[Phellinus rhabarbarinus(Berk.)G.Cunn.]中分离到5个化合物,经鉴定分别为2个苯环衍生物、2个三萜和1个甾体化合物。[结论]所有分离到的化合物均为首次从黑壳木层孔菌中分离到。
